Eight Scouts, five leaders and one former leader gathered on November 22 for our tenth annual event to bake pies for charities. This year, for our first time, we made the dough for the pies tops as part of our assembly line.

We baked a total of 60 pies (17 apple, 4 pumpkin, 15 blueberry and 24 cherry). The next morning, we boxed them up and delivered 20 to the Veterans Inc shelter on Grove Street and 39 to the Friendly House food pantry. We ate one pie.
